Methyl 11(Z)-docosenoate is an unsaturated fatty acid methyl ester (FAME) that primarily targets lipid metabolism. It exhibits various biological activities, including roles in lipid signaling and membrane fluidity. This compound is utilized in research applications involving lipid biochemistry, studying fatty acid metabolism, and exploring the effects of unsaturated fatty acids on biological systems.
